Job summary and scope
The practice nurse is responsible for providing nursing services to the practice population, within the boundaries of the role. They will support patients to be healthy, monitor patients with long-term conditions, and deliver health prevention, promotion and screening activities.
This will include but is not limited to assessing patients; planning and implementing treatment protocols; and reviewing and tracking progress.
- Implement and evaluate treatment plans for patients with long-term conditions

- Take and test pathology samples from patients for analysis (blood, sputum, urine, etc)
- Care for patients with uncomplicated wounds, including (but not limited to):
- Removal of sutures
- Wound assessment
- Wound cleaning and dressing
- Management of burns and scalds
- Ulcer care, (pressure dressings training not needed)
- Implement and participate in vaccination and immunisation programmes
